Cod sursa(job #276793)
Utilizator | Data | 11 martie 2009 12:39:58 | |
---|---|---|---|
Problema | Factorial | Scor | 5 |
Compilator | cpp | Status | done |
Runda | Arhiva de probleme | Marime | 0.32 kb |
#include<fstream.h>
ifstream f("fact.in"); ofstream g("fact.out");
long long nr=2,p,cinci=0;
int main() {
f>>p;
while(cinci<p){ long long aux=nr;
while(aux%5==0) {cinci++;aux/=5;}
nr++;
}
if(cinci==p) g<<nr;
else g<<"-1";
f.close();
g.close();
return 0;
}